Stapled wrappers. pp. Very good plus: minimal wear and light toning. <br /> <br /> This book tells the story of the Freehold New Jersey center for migratory farm workers and their families. It's notable because its author and illustrator were both African American women. Per the introduction the author Lenora B. Willette was<br /> <br /> “a Southerner by birth and she first became interested in the plight of the migrants displaced from the plantations through the mechanization of cotton. Active in civic affairs and in the Consumers League of New Jersey she worked to secure the Migrant Labor Law and was appointed one of the five public members to the first Board by Governor Walter E. Edge. She was chosen to make a study of migrant education in the southern and western states as the official representative of the State. Her recommendations were used as a guide in setting up a school of education for children—the Freehold Summer School for Migrant Children; the first of its kind in the nation.â€<br /> <br /> Willette was the also the president of the New Jersey State Federation of Colored Women's Clubs.<br /> <br /> The artist was presumably Lenora's sister Naida Willette Page who contributed the cover art as well as two full page internal illustrations. Naida Willette Page initially studied engineering at Howard University before making national news in 1950 as the first African American to be trained at Johns Hopkins for medical illustration. She graduated from Johns Hopkins in 1951 later worked as the Howard University College of Medicine medical illustrator and was the Art Director for the Journal of the National Medical Association where she often illustrated the covers that featured historic Black doctors. Several sources state that she's considered the first African American medical illustrator.<br /> <br /> A terrific combination of female author and illustrator. 189625811896. An engraved poster welcoming the new year of 1896. A naked woman representing 1896 is at the helm of a boat which has the debris of 1895 in its wake. Tipped onto white backing cardboard. Signed in the plate A. Willette. To the bottom right is 'Phg V. Michel'. The debris of 1895 includes the words 'Panama' and 'Arton'. These appear to relate to Émile Arton a Jewish financier who was arrested in November 1895 for his part in financing in the Panama crisis. Adolph Willette was strongly anti-Semitic. Poster is clean and tidy with no significant marks. Black and white. Overall in Very Good condition. Poster size: 610 x 460 mm 24 x 18 inches. Adolphe Léon Willette 1857–1926 was a French painter illustrator caricaturist and lithographer as well as an architect of the famous Moulin Rouge cabaret. Willette ran as an "anti-Semitic" candidate in the 9th arrondissement of Paris for the September 1889 legislative elections. Rare. Une affiche gravée accueillant le nouvel an 1896. Adolphe Willette original lithograph illustrated advertisement showing a topless young cabaret performer carrying a round gift box marked "Bonne Annee" stepping through a large oval frame as a young girl assists. Signed in the plate at lower left.<br /> <br /> Willette 1857-1926 was a French caricaturist painter lithographer and architect of the Moulin Rouge whose many works in the illustrated press Le Pied de Nez le Courier Francais and Le Rire often appeared under various pseudonyms. He was active during the Belle Epoque and Art Nouveau period and was a member of the Cornet Society a group of artists musicians writers academics and playwrights who gathered at various restaurants around Montmartre. Known for his lithographs posters paintings and illustrations Willette was called the "Pierrot of Montmartre" because of his fascination with this comedia del'arte character. Willette's famous 'Parce Domine' painting with many Pierrot figures first decorated the Montmartre cabaret Le Chat Noir; it is now at the Montmartre Museum.
